Jessie Ware returns with new single 'Overtime'

Having spent the last few years crafting herself as a soaring pop beacon, Jessie Ware is now returning to her club roots with the release of a brand new single.

The new track 'Overtime' was premiered on Annie Mac's Radio 1 show last night (3rd October), and sees the frontwoman team up with production duo Bicep and Simian Mobile Disco's James Ford to deliver a ball-busted dancefloor filler, which she has described as a taste of things to come.

'Overtime' is her first new cut since her 2017 album 'Glasshouse', and you can check it out in the player below.
